Mit der steigenden Popularität von Twitter ist es keine Überraschung, dass immer mehr Blogger nach Wegen suchen, ihre Inhalte über Twitter zu verbreiten. Mit dem Start von Twitter @Anywhere erhalten Blogger jetzt eine einfache Möglichkeit, Twitter @anywhere in ihren Blog einzubetten und ihren Lesern zu ermöglichen, schnell einen Tweet zu posten oder den Bloggern zu folgen, ohne die Seite zu verlassen. Wenn Sie noch herausfinden, wie es geht, können Sie es in WordPress auf verschiedene Arten tun:

Registrieren Sie den Twitter-API-Schlüssel

Bevor Sie beginnen, etwas zu tun, müssen Sie zunächst einen Twitter API-Schlüssel unter http://dev.twitter.com/apps registrieren. Mit dem API-Schlüssel können Sie Ihr @anywhere auf Ihrer Website einbetten.

1. Gehen Sie zu http://dev.twitter.com/apps. Melde dich mit deinem Twitter Benutzernamen und Passwort an.

2. Klicken Sie auf Eine neue Anwendung registrieren

3. Füllen Sie das Formular aus. Sie können der Anwendung einen beliebigen Namen geben. Es gibt nur eines zu beachten: Wählen Sie im Standardzugriffstyp Lese- und Schreibzugriff .

4. Sobald Sie Ihre App registriert haben, sollten Sie Ihren API-Schlüssel auf dem nächsten Bildschirm sehen. Das ist alles was du jetzt brauchst.

WordPress @Anywhere Plugins

Nachdem Sie nun Ihren Twitter-API-Schlüssel erhalten haben, sehen wir uns die verfügbaren Plugins an, mit denen Sie @anywhere in Ihre Site einbetten können.

1. Twitter @Anywhere Plus

Dies muss das umfassendste @Anywhere Plugin in der gesamten Liste sein. Es ist gut implementiert und enthält die meisten Funktionen. Alles, was Sie tun müssen, ist die Aktivierung der notwendigen Optionen auf der Einstellungsseite und es wird automatisch so konfiguriert, dass es an der richtigen Stelle angezeigt wird.

Zu den unterstützten Funktionen gehören:

  • Automatische Verlinkung: Alle @Benutzername-Texte werden in Twitter-Links umgewandelt
  • Hover-Karte: Twitter-Info wird angezeigt, wenn Sie den Mauszeiger über den Link bewegen
  • Tweetbox: Sende einen Tweet direkt von deiner Seite. Nützlich für Retweets.
  • Retweet-Taste
  • Folgen Schaltfläche
  • Fügen Sie benutzerdefinierte Tweet Box mit Shortcode ein
  • URL-Kürzung - bit.ly

Eine Sache, die in diesem Plugin fehlt, ist die Möglichkeit, Code außerhalb des Inhaltsbereichs zu platzieren. Wenn Sie eine Tweet-Box in Ihrer Kopf-, Fußzeilen- oder sogar Seitenleisten-Widget platzieren möchten, erlaubt Ihnen dieses Plugin dies nicht.

Pro : Einfach zu bedienen und es funktioniert einfach.

Con : @Anywhere kann nicht außerhalb des Inhaltsbereichs eingebettet werden.

2. Überall

Dies ist eine sehr einfache Implementierung von @Anywhere. Im Moment unterstützt es nur die automatische Verknüpfung, Hover-Karte und Tweetbox.

Wie das Twitter @Anywhere Plus-Plugin können Sie Ihre Tweetbox so anpassen, dass sie vor oder nach dem Inhalt erscheint. Es gibt auch die manuelle Option, mit der Sie die Tweetbox überall im Inhalt platzieren können, aber es gibt sehr wenig Dokumentation / Anweisungen, wie Sie sie verwenden können.

Pro : Einfach

Con : Begrenzte Funktionen und fehlende Gebrauchsanweisungen

The Hacker Way - Den @Anywhere-Code manuell hinzufügen

Es gibt viele Gründe, warum das Hinzufügen des Twitter @Anywhere-Codes eine bessere Idee ist als die Verwendung eines Plugins:

1. Weniger Overhead, weniger Systemressourcen verwendend.

2. Es ist einfach zu implementieren. Sogar Neulinge können es alleine machen.

3. Sie können es so anpassen, dass es überall auf der Website angezeigt wird. Es ist nicht nur auf den Inhaltsbereich beschränkt.

Hinzufügen des Javascript

Öffnen Sie die Datei theme functions.php und fügen Sie den folgenden Code am Ende der Datei ein.

 $ api_key = "Ersetzen durch Ihren API-Schlüssel"; wp_enqueue_script ("twitter-anywhere", "http://platform.twitter.com/anywhere.js?id={$api_key}&v=1"); add_action ("wp_head", "twitter_anywhere"); Funktion twitter_anywhere () {echo ''; echo 'twttr.anywhere (onAnywhereLoad);'; echo 'Funktion onAnywhereLoad (twitter) {twitter.hovercards (); } '; Echo ''; } 

Speichern und auf Ihren Server hochladen. Sie haben soeben die Funktion "Karten mit Hover-Karten" auf Ihrer Website implementiert.

Um ein Tweet-Feld hinzuzufügen, fügen Sie den folgenden Code an der Stelle ein, an der das Tweet-Feld angezeigt werden soll.

Ist es nicht einfach?

Ein kleiner Trick: Hinzufügen der Hover-Karte zu Ihrem Twitter-Icon

Wenn Sie auf Ihrer Website ein Twitter-Symbol haben, können Sie eine Hover-Karte darin einbetten.

Ersetzen Sie im obigen Code die Funktion twitter_anywhere () durch Folgendes:

 Funktion twitter_anywhere () {echo ''; echo 'twttr.anywhere (onAnywhereLoad);'; echo 'Funktion onAnywhereLoad (twitter) {twitter.hovercards (); twitter ("# hovercard"). hovercards ({Benutzername: function (node) {return node.title;}}); } '; Echo ''; } 

Als nächstes fügen Sie die Attribute id = "hovercard" und title = "@ your-twitter-username" zu Ihrem Twitter-Icon hinzu. Es sollte so aussehen

Weitere Informationen finden Sie in der Twitter @Anywhere-Dokumentation für weitere Details.

Haben Sie Twitter @Anywhere in Ihre Website eingebettet? Wenn ja, welche Art verwenden Sie?